One of the key benefits of using statistics and data analytics in studying ancient civilizations is the ability to identify patterns and trends that may have otherwise gone unnoticed. By collecting and analyzing large datasets of archaeological evidence, such as pottery shards, architectural remains, and inscriptions, researchers can discern patterns in trade routes, migration patterns, and social structures of ancient societies. For example, through statistical analysis of ancient trade networks, scholars have been able to trace the movement of goods and cultural exchange between different civilizations, revealing the interconnectedness of the ancient world in ways never before imagined. Furthermore, data analytics techniques such as network analysis and spatial mapping have provided new tools for visualizing and understanding ancient landscapes and urban environments. By using geographic information systems (GIS) to map out ancient cities and settlements, researchers can gain insights into the layout of urban infrastructure, the distribution of resources, and the social organization of ancient societies. For instance, by analyzing the spatial distribution of artifacts within a city, archaeologists can infer the locations of marketplaces, residential areas, and public buildings, painting a more detailed picture of how people lived and interacted in ancient times. Moreover, statistics and data analytics have also been instrumental in dating archaeological sites and artifacts, helping researchers establish chronologies and understand the timelines of different civilizations. By applying radiocarbon dating techniques and statistical models to analyze the age of ancient materials, archaeologists can determine when key events occurred, such as the construction of monumental structures, the development of writing systems, or the decline of a civilization. This chronological framework enables researchers to piece together the historical narrative of ancient societies and gain a deeper understanding of their cultural evolution over time.
